摘    要:合成了一种新型的导电配位型化合物(FeCp2)0.65Ni(C3S7)2]。通过EA,ICP,1H NMR,UV对该化合物进行了表征,并通过循环伏安法和变温四探针法对其电化学性质进行了研究。结果表明分子中S原子个数增多以及二茂铁阳离子(FeCp2+)的引入有利于导电性能的提高。

Abstract:A new type of conductive coordination compound(FeCp2)0.65Ni(C3S7)2] was synthesized,and was characterized by EA,ICP,IR,1H NMR,UV.The electrochemical property was studied by cyclic voltammetry and four probe methods.It was concluded that the electrical conductivity of the compound can be improved by increasing sulfur atoms and adding FeCp2+.
